Oklahoma District UPCI Campground Introduce
For local users seeking a unique type of "camping near me" that goes beyond traditional recreational campgrounds, the Oklahoma District UPCI Campground offers a distinct environment and set of services. This facility, associated with the United Pentecostal Church International (UPCI) Oklahoma District, serves primarily as a gathering place for religious events, retreats, and fellowship. While it may offer camping facilities, its primary focus is on providing a supportive and community-oriented space for spiritual growth and connection.
